Offering a Lower Price to Buy Car at Lease-end by rob222
Sep 15, 2008 (7:33 am)
Reply
My 4-year GX lease expires at the end of January. The buy-out price is $25,000. Is it possible to offer a price lower than the buy-out price? If so, how is this done?
#231 of 259
Re: Offering a Lower Price to Buy Car at Lease-end [rob222] by Car_man HOST
Sep 26, 2008 (2:59 am)
Reply

Replying to: rob222 (Sep 15, 2008 7:33 am)

Hi rob222. It's absolutely possible to offer the bank that you are leasing though, which I assume is Lexus Financial Services, a lower price than your truck's official lease-end purchase price. Whether they will accept your offer is another matter. More often than not banks won't. Still, you don't have anything to lose by trying.
 
Place a call directly to LFS a month or two before the scheduled end of your lease and tell them that you are considering purchasing your truck but that you want a better price. If your initial contact there is unwilling to work with you, work your way up the ladder to a manager and see if you have any better luck. There's no guarantee that they will be willing to work with you, but it's worth a shot.

Re: October Lease Deal [rob222] by Car_man HOST
Oct 16, 2008 (5:41 pm)
Reply

Replying to: rob222 (Oct 14, 2008 1:49 pm)

Hey Rob. The best way to tell if this lease is a good deal is to look at its selling price in relation to either its MSRP or better yet, its dealer invoice price. The selling prices of lease vehicles are negotiable, just as if you were paying cash for or financing them.
 
Here is the information about the lease program that you requested. Lexus Financial Services' current buy rate lease money factor and residual value for a 36 month lease of a 2008 Lexus GX 470 without the entertainment system with 15,000 miles per year are .00135 and 49%, respectively for consumers who qualify for its Tier 1+ credit tier.
